  2. Fairy Forts

    There is a fairy fort in Pat Ryan's land in Shanakill...

    There is a fairy fort in Pat Ryan's land in Shanakill. It is by the side of the road as you go to Clonmore. It is the shape of a three corner field and there are all big ancient trees surrounding it. Mr. Ryan never cut a tree around it and it is a very lonesome part of the road.

  3. Fairy Forts

    There is a fairy fort in Andy Maher's land in Gurtnagoona...

    There is a fairy fort in Andy Maher's land in Gurtnagoona. There is a lot of trees and bushes around it.
    There is a fairy fort in Maher's field, Oldcastle. There are a lot of bushes around it. There are two houses near it, Coles and Maddens.
    There is a fairy fort in Denis Carroll's outside Roscrea. There are two houses near it.
